Now Hiring Teachers for North Smithfield & Woonsocket Youth Programs

Now Hiring Teachers for North Smithfield & Woonsocket Youth Programs

July 24, 2015 by Thea Lowe

NeighborWorks Blackstone River Valley youth programs are looking for enthusiastic and flexible teachers to teach and build relationships with youth program participants at our Woonsocket and North Smithfield sites. Located in the Constitution Hill (Woonsocket) and Marshfield Commons (North Smithfield) neighborhoods, our programs serve youth in grades K-5.
